Gokla - Kareli, Narsimhapur
Gokla is a village situated in the Kareli tehsil of Narsimhapur district, Madhya Pradesh. It is located approximately 26 km from the tehsil headquarters in Kareli and around 42 km from the district headquarters in Narsimhapur. Gursi serves as the Gram Panchayat for Gokla village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Gokla is 491303. The village covers a total geographical area of 224.66 hectares and falls under the 487330 pincode. Kareli is the nearest town, located about 26 km away.
Gokla village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Narsingpur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Hoshangabad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Gokla
According to the 2011 Census, Gokla village had a total population of 486 people, including 274 males and 212 females, living in 114 households. The sex ratio was 774 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 70.46%, with male literacy at 82.48% and female literacy at 54.75%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 7,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 229.
The table below presents a detailed demographic breakdown of the village, including separate male and female figures for each population category.
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 486 | 274 | 212 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 73 | 40 | 33 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 7 | 3 | 4 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 229 | 136 | 93 |
| Literate Population | 291 | 193 | 98 |
| Illiterate Population | 195 | 81 | 114 |

Transport and Connectivity of Gokla
Gokla is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within 5-10 km of the village. The nearest railway station is Kareli, while the nearest airport is Jabalpur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 77.9 km.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Kareli to Gokla is about 26 km, with a usual travel time of around 1-1.25 hours. Similarly, the road distance from Narsimhapur to Gokla is about 42 km, with the usual travel time around ~1.2 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
